Charles Addams, New York Cartoonist

imageBetween the celebration of Ronald Searle's 90th birthday and a translation being made widely available of Yoshiharu Tsuge's hilarious interview given in support of what is as of right now his last work, it's been a great week for the reconsideration of formidable cartoonists. So it seems fitting to see a substantial article about a new exhibition of Charles Addams' work, rare for being organized around Addams as a Gotham luminary as opposed to the shadow patriarch of his Addams Family. Also, apparently the exhibit includes Irvin Penn's totally bitchin' portrait of New York cartoonists, 1947, something at which I'm always happy to stare.
